Question:
The mean of a population is 76 and the standard deviation is 14. The shape of the population is unknown. Determine the probability of each of the following occurring from this population.
a. A random sample of size 35 yielding a sample mean of 79 or more.
b. A random sample of size 140 yielding a sample mean of between 74 and 77
c. A random sample of size 219 yielding a sample mean of less than 76.5
